Guernsey Electricity to support new ‘Eat Drink & Be Local’ festival

As part of its commitment to building a strong community, Guernsey Electricity is supporting the new Guernsey festival of food, drink and artisanal crafts – ‘Eat Drink & Be Local’ (EDABL) – this summer.

The festival, which aims to showcase a plethora of local entrepreneurs, will be held across four St Peter Port Seafront Sundays in June, July, August and September culminating in a Festival Finale weekend at the end of September.

“As the Island’s sole electricity distributor, we are passionate about supporting homegrown talent as well as connecting with, and supporting, the local community. We’re therefore really excited to be part of ‘Eat Drink & Be Local’ and support its mission of celebrating Guernsey’s innovative and creative producers,” said Clare Packman, Guernsey Electricity communications and digital advisor.

Organiser of EDABL Guernsey Luke Wheadon said: “Guernsey Electricity’s kind sponsorship and support is not only vital to our ability to successfully run the festival but it’s also really encouraging. We’re extremely grateful and very much looking forward to working with them over the summer months.”

The four Seafront Sundays will take place on Crown Pier and along the seafront in St Peter Port on Sunday 2 June, Sunday 28 July, Sunday 18 August, and Sunday 1 September between 10am and 5pm. Islanders can expect to see a quality display of local producers, lectures and talks from food and drink authors as well as demonstrations by local and visiting chefs and atmospheric live music. There will also be activities for children including home-made pizza making.

In addition to sponsorship from Guernsey Electricity and Specsavers, EDABL is supported by a grant from the Committee for Economic Development. The grant is awarded to support events that will help the development and growth of the tourism and hospitality sector.
